The Greatest Ears in Town: The Arif Mardin Story is a fascinating documentary film that explores the life and career of one of the most influential music producers in history, Arif Mardin. Directed by Doug Biro and Joe Mardin and released in 2010, the film features interviews with some of the biggest names in the music industry, including Quincy Jones, Phil Collins, and the late Robin Gibb of the Bee Gees.

The film begins with Mardin's childhood in Istanbul, Turkey, and follows him as he emigrates to the United States and settles in New York City. There, he begins working in the music industry as an arranger and producer, eventually landing a job at Atlantic Records.

Over the course of his career, Mardin worked with some of the biggest names in music, including Aretha Franklin, Dusty Springfield, Bette Midler, Chaka Khan, and many more. He was particularly known for his work with the Bee Gees, with whom he collaborated on some of their biggest hits, including "Jive Talkin'" and "Stayin' Alive."

The film pays tribute to Mardin's immense talent and creativity, showcasing his innovative techniques and unique approach to music production. Through interviews with his colleagues and friends, viewers gain insight into his work processes, his philosophy on music, and his lasting impact on the industry.
